As an Aircraft Engine Mechanic II, you will put your skills and powerplant expertise to use performing overhauls, major inspections, and routine maintenance on Honeywell turbofan engines (TFE731, HTF7000).
What you'll do:
- Utilize precision instruments such as micrometers, torque wrenches, and calipers to inspect, troubleshoot, and repair engines and APUs
- Navigate, research, and reference technical digital documents, OEM Light and Heavy Maintenance manuals.
- Perform routine maintenance and major inspections on Honeywell engine types and models.
- Disassembly and re-assembly of Honeywell engine types and models.
- Remove and reinstall engines on aircraft for major periodic inspections and core zone inspections.
- Perform incoming and outgoing engine runs and line maintenance, as required.
- Evaluates removed components for serviceability and document discrepancies.
- Document all work accomplished in a clear, concise and accurate manner.
- Accomplishes Service Bulletins, Repair Letters and Airworthiness Directive.
- Participate in ongoing training initiatives on and off site through partners like CAE, FlightSafety, and Honeywell.
Position Requirements:
- Minimum of 3 years of experience performing heavy maintenance on turbofan engines in an overhaul/MRO environment.
- Must have a valid FAA Powerplant License required.
- High School diploma or GED.
- Authorized to work in the United States.
Preferred Characteristics:
- 5+ years of experience inspecting, maintaining and repairing turbofan engines
- Experience working on the Honeywell HTF7000 and/or TFE731 engine lines.
- Valid FAA Airframe and Powerplant License.
- Technical training on corporate aircraft and engines in the areas of inspections, maintenance, preventive maintenance, alterations, and repairs.
- Previous experience locating and applying FAA regulations, Advisory Circulars, Orders, and Notices.
